About The Position

The School of Business invites applications for a full-time accounting faculty position. This role, beginning July 1, 2026, primarily focuses on teaching accounting, with potential to include areas of business administration. The ideal candidate will integrate theoretical knowledge of accounting and business with a biblical worldview and practical experience. Teaching will be predominantly face-to-face on campus, with some online instruction required. Responsibilities include student advising, collaboration with faculty, participation in assessment and continuous improvement, and engagement in departmental activities. Applications will be reviewed immediately until the position is filled.
